
Hotplates and hotplate stirrers are essential instruments in any laboratory, providing reliable heating and mixing solutions for various applications. Their versatility makes them ideal for chemists, biologists, and researchers alike.
When selecting a hotplate or hotplate stirrer, understanding the specific needs of your experiments will ensure optimal performance and results. This guide will equip you with the necessary insights to make informed decisions.

When choosing a hotplate or hotplate stirrer, consider factors like temperature range, size, and power supply. It's essential to select a model that meets the specific requirements of your experiments to ensure safety and efficiency.
Furthermore, look for features such as digital displays and programmable settings, which can enhance usability and precision in your laboratory work.

The market for hotplates and hotplate stirrers varies widely in pricing, typically ranging from affordable to high-end models. Prices can be influenced by the brand, features, and specifications of the equipment.
It's advisable to compare different models and their functionalities to find the best fit that aligns with your budget and laboratory needs.

Assessing value for money involves looking beyond the initial cost. Consider the longevity, efficiency, and performance of the equipment. A higher initial investment may result in better quality and lower operational costs over time.
Research user reviews and ratings to gauge the reliability of the model you’re considering, which can further inform your investment decision.

The lifespan of hotplates and hotplate stirrers can vary based on usage and maintenance practices. Regular cleaning and proper storage can significantly extend the life of these instruments.
Always refer to the manufacturer's instructions for maintenance tips to ensure your equipment remains in optimal working condition for years to come.
